Lines Matching refs:index
69 Permedia2WriteAddress (ScrnInfoPtr pScrn, CARD32 index)
73 GLINT_SLOW_WRITE_REG(index, PM2DACWriteAddress);
85 Permedia2ReadAddress (ScrnInfoPtr pScrn, CARD32 index)
90 GLINT_SLOW_WRITE_REG(index, PM2DACReadAddress);
109 int i, index, shift = 0, j, repeat = 1;
117 index = indices[i];
119 Permedia2WriteAddress(pScrn, (index << shift)+j);
120 Permedia2WriteData(pScrn, colors[index].red);
121 Permedia2WriteData(pScrn, colors[index].green);
122 Permedia2WriteData(pScrn, colors[index].blue);
125 GLINT_SLOW_WRITE_REG(index, TexelLUTIndex);
126 GLINT_SLOW_WRITE_REG((colors[index].red & 0xFF) |
127 ((colors[index].green & 0xFF) << 8) |
128 ((colors[index].blue & 0xFF) << 16),
142 int i, index, j;
145 index = indices[i];
147 Permedia2WriteAddress(pScrn, (index << 2)+j);
148 Permedia2WriteData(pScrn, colors[index >> 1].red);
149 Permedia2WriteData(pScrn, colors[index].green);
150 Permedia2WriteData(pScrn, colors[index >> 1].blue);
152 GLINT_SLOW_WRITE_REG(index, TexelLUTIndex);
153 GLINT_SLOW_WRITE_REG((colors[index].red & 0xFF) |
154 ((colors[index].green & 0xFF) << 8) |
155 ((colors[index].blue & 0xFF) << 16),
158 if(index <= 31) {
160 Permedia2WriteAddress(pScrn, (index << 3)+j);
161 Permedia2WriteData(pScrn, colors[index].red);
162 Permedia2WriteData(pScrn, colors[(index << 1) + 1].green);
163 Permedia2WriteData(pScrn, colors[index].blue);